The Saints are hoping to wrap up the NFC South title tomorrow when they visit the Tampa Bay Bucaneers. The Bucs have won their last two and they lead the NFL in passing offense.
Tampa Bay quarterback Jameis Winston has thrown four touchdown passes and zero interceptions in the last two games. Defensive tackle Sheldon Rankins says they know what to expect from the Bucs…

Kick-off is noon and there’s a good chance for rain at kick-off.
The Pelicans had an eight point lead in the fourthe quarter, but lost to the Grizzlies 107-103 last night.
New Orleans was just 7-of-29 from three point territory and they had 18
turnovers that led to 26 points for Memphis. The Pels fall to 13-14 for the season.
There were plenty of points scored during day two of the 2018 AllState Sugar Bowl prep classic. Last night in the 3A title game, Sterlington could not hold on to an eight-point halftime lead and lost to Eunice 59-47.
It’s the Bobcats first state championship since 1982. Simeon Ardoin rushed for three scores.
Michael Hollins rushed for 240 yards and four touchdowns as U-High defeated St. Thomas More 55-46 as the Cubs won their first back-to-back titles in school history.
Amite won its first state title since 2004 as the Warriors beat Welsh 47-20. Amani Gilmore threw five touchowns and ran for another.
Tonight the 5A title game features West Monroe versus defending champion Zachary. Kick off will be after 7 PM.
LSU linebacker Devin White told a Baton Rouge radio station it was a no brainer for him to play in the Fiesta Bowl. And the future first round pick says he’s not made decision on whether he’ll turn pro and enter the 2019 NFL draft..
